开云体育There was a bug which meant that connecting to the application defined by the 4th parameter didn't work with QtTermTCP or the Web Terminal. This was fixed in an early 6.0.22 beta.The documentation for the USER line includes "You may also set a user to automatically connect to one of your applications by adding the Application as a 4th parameter". Maybe this isn't entirely clear, but in this context application means the value from one of your APPLICATION lines, and NODE isn't an application. What the code actually does is pass whatever is specified to the command interpreter, so it doesn't need to be an application, and NODE causes the display of the Nodes List. 73, John On 09/06/2022 22:43, Charlie Hein
